From df60073f4fb06ea2d16984635e0714bae8a1f8e9 Mon Sep 17 00:00:00 2001
From: quanwei <419654421@qq.com>
Date: Mon, 22 Dec 2025 18:03:35 +0800
Subject: [PATCH] 1.在总后台首页装修增加了活动专区和智能匹配 模块 2.目前活动专区获取的是发布需求最新的数据,智能匹配是用户没登录前也是获取发布需求最新数据,登录后会根据用户发布的需求,通过分类匹配到对应的数据 3.修复缴纳保证金报错 4.修复发布需求报错
---
shop_vue/src/views/plus/release/demandproject/index.vue | 20 +++++++++++++++++++-
1 files changed, 19 insertions(+), 1 deletions(-)
diff --git a/shop_vue/src/views/plus/release/demandproject/index.vue b/shop_vue/src/views/plus/release/demandproject/index.vue
index bc802d1..e2b6559 100644
--- a/shop_vue/src/views/plus/release/demandproject/index.vue
+++ b/shop_vue/src/views/plus/release/demandproject/index.vue
@@ -26,6 +26,12 @@
<div class="table-wrap">
<el-table size="small" :data="tableData" border style="width: 100%" v-loading="loading">
<el-table-column prop="project_id" label="ID" width="100"></el-table-column>
+ <el-table-column prop="nickName" label="发布用户"></el-table-column>
+ <el-table-column prop="nickName" label="微信头像">
+ <template slot-scope="scope">
+ <img :src="scope.row.user.avatarUrl" width="30px" height="30px" />
+ </template>
+ </el-table-column>
<el-table-column prop="name" label="标题"></el-table-column>
<el-table-column prop="category.name" label="分类" width="200"></el-table-column>
<el-table-column prop="price" label="预算" width="200"></el-table-column>
@@ -36,10 +42,11 @@
<span v-if="scope.row.status == 2" class="green">已驳回</span>
</template>
</el-table-column>
- <el-table-column fixed="right" label="操作" width="150">
+ <el-table-column fixed="right" label="操作" width="200">
<template slot-scope="scope">
<el-button v-if="scope.row.status == 0" @click="shClick(scope.row)" type="text" size="small">审核</el-button>
<el-button @click="editClick(scope.row)" type="text" size="small" >详情</el-button>
+ <el-button @click="evaluateClick(scope.row)" type="text" size="small" >评论列表</el-button>
<el-button @click="deleteClick(scope.row)" type="text" size="small">删除</el-button>
</template>
</el-table-column>
@@ -140,6 +147,17 @@
this.getTableList();
},
+ evaluateClick(item) {
+ let self = this;
+ let params = item.project_id;
+ this.$router.push({
+ path: '/plus/release/evaluate/list',
+ query: {
+ project_id: params
+ }
+ });
+ },
+
/*打开编辑*/
editClick(item) {
this.userModel = deepClone(item);
--
Gitblit v1.9.2